We pick b.root-servers.net, one of the 13 root servers (1), and ask it about d.vu and learn that vu is delegated to four name servers (2), so we ask efate.vanuatu.com.vu where we learn that d.vu is delegated to two name servers, including ns2.vidahost.com (3), so we ask that one and get the following answer:
D.vu is a domain controlled by two domain name servers at vidahost.com. Both are on different IP networks. Incoming mail for d.vu is handled by five mail servers at googlemail.com and google.com having a total of 48 IP numbers. There are 14 duplicated IP numbers. Some of them are on the same IP network. D.vu has one IP number (188.65.113.171), but the reverse is ipswich.footholds.net.
